The life of an unsuccessful writer is transformed by a top-secret 'smart drug' that allows him to use 100% of his brain and become a perfect version of himself. His enhanced abilities soon attract shadowy forces that threaten his new life. Information is revealed strategically, keeping viewers engaged as they piece together clues alongside Bradley Cooper.
